Entry From
Flora Capensis, Vol 5, page 1, (1912) Author: By C. B. CLARKE.
Names
MONECHMA arenicola C. B. Clarke [family ACANTHACEAE], in Dyer, Fl. Trop. Afr. v. 218
Justicia arenicola Engl. [family ACANTHACEAE], in Engl. Jahrb. x. 264; Lindau in Engl. Jahrb. xix. 151, and in Engl. & Prantl, Pflanzenfam. iv. 3B, 349.
Information
a viscous pubescent undershrub; branches 6–10 in. long, internodes mostly 1/6– 1/3 in. long; leaves up to 1 by 1/4– 1/3 in., lanceolate, acute, subsessile, with long white hairs; flowers solitary, few, approximate towards the ends of the branchlets; bracteoles 2, scarcely 1/4 in. long, linear; calyx 1/4 in. long, 4-partite nearly to the base; lobes linear; corolla 1/2 in. long; one anther-cell lower than the other, tailed, pollen ellipsoid, with 2 stopples, tubercles minute in 2 rows on each side of each stopple; capsule 1/3 in. long, pubescent, 2-seeded; seeds smooth, blotched. null
Range
Also frequent in Lower Guinea.
Distribution
KALAHARI REGION Prieska Div.; Zand Valley, Burchell, 1631! Hopetown Div.; near Hopetown, 4500 ft., Muskett in Bolus Herb., 2568!
